Top landmarks in Joshua Tree

Learn more about Joshua Tree

Bizarre rock formations and twisted trees create a landscape that feels like another planet in Joshua Tree National Park. Scramble over massive boulders during the day, then witness one of California's darkest night skies as the Milky Way unfolds overhead. The Hi-Desert Cultural Centre offers artistic respite from the desert sun, while the Noah Purifoy Foundation displays haunting outdoor sculptures made from desert debris. Local creativity continues at the World Famous Crochet Museum, housed in a former photo booth, and the Joshua Tree Art Gallery. Visit the farmers' market for local treats before heading back to the park for sunset, when the rocks glow amber and the Joshua trees cast otherworldly shadows across the desert floor.

Top locations to stay in Joshua Tree

Some great areas to stay in when visiting Joshua Tree, California, are Yucca Valley, Pioneertown, and Landers. Yucca Valley offers natural beauty and convenient amenities; Pioneertown is perfect for families with its Old West charm; and Landers features unique attractions and a serene atmosphere. For first-time visitors, Pioneertown is best suited, combining adventure and family-friendly activities.

  1. Yucca ValleyOpens in a new window: Yucca Valley is an excellent base for your Joshua Tree adventure, blending natural beauty with a laid-back vibe. This area is known for its stunning desert landscapes and proximity to Joshua Tree National Park, making it perfect for nature enthusiasts. You can explore unique rock formations, hike scenic trails, and enjoy breathtaking sunsets. The town also boasts quirky shops and local art galleries, giving you a taste of the local culture. Plus, its convenient access to amenities ensures a comfortable stay while you soak in the tranquil surroundings.
  2. PioneertownOpens in a new window: Pioneertown is a charming, Old West-style town that offers a unique experience for families and those seeking a slice of history. Originally built as a movie set in the 1940s, it features picturesque streets lined with vintage storefronts. You can catch live music at the iconic Pappy & Harriet's, explore the local shops, or take a stroll through the dusty streets. The nearby natural scenery invites outdoor activities, making it an engaging spot for all ages.
  3. LandersOpens in a new window: Landers is a hidden gem for those looking to escape the hustle and bustle. This small, quiet community is renowned for its stunning night skies, making it ideal for stargazing. It's close to the Integratron, a fascinating historical structure known for its unique sound baths and wellness sessions. Enjoy the serene desert environment while discovering local art installations. Landers offers a peaceful retreat where you can truly unwind and appreciate the beauty of the high desert.

Best time to go to Joshua Tree

Joshua Tree experiences its lowest average temperature in December, at 47.8°F (8.8°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 86.0°F (30.0°C). December is typically the wettest month.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ere in Joshua Tree, February to April are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is sunny, with no r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, August, October, and November are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by no rainfall and sunny conditions.
